  • Abstract
    An implementation of a multilevel balanced clock-tree distribution scheme that improves the performance of ASICs considerably is described. Layout process and the CAD tools are briefly described, and the results are tabulated for differing complexities of real customer designs. The focus of this clock-tree distribution scheme is on minimizing the clock skew, on reducing the total clock delay from the clock driver to a clock pin, on improving rise/fall times, and on minimizing the silicon area consumed by the clock circuitry
